140-Year-Old Church Expansion Plans Aired at Hearing Today

Yountville Community Church wants to expand into adjacent residential building.

Yountville Town Council tonight will conduct a controversial public hearing on expansion plans for Yountville Community Church.

The hearing is at 6 p.m. at Yountville Community Center.

According to the Yountville Sun, the church, established in 1874, would like to take over a vacant home at Webber and Yount streets, just adjacent to the church property at 6621 Yount St.
